205 ILCS 675/10

A revolving credit plan between a financial institution and a borrower shall be governed by the laws of this State

Known as the Illinois Financial Services Development Act

The act spans §§ 205-675-1 to 205-675-9 (12 sections).

P.A. 85-1432.

All terms, conditions and other provisions of and relating to a plan, including, without limitation, provisions relating to the method of determining the outstanding unpaid indebtedness on which interest is applied, time periods within which interest charges may be avoided, change in terms, requirements, rights to charge and collect attorneys' fees, court and collection costs and the computing of periodic interest or charges, shall be and hereby are deemed to be material to the determination of interest applicable to a plan under Illinois law, Section 85 of the National Bank Act and Sections 521 through 523 of the Depository Institutions Deregulation and Monetary Control Act of 1980.
